Think you can design an aluminum foil boat that can hold pennies? How about 100 pennies?
Do you know what makes a boat float? Learn why boats achieve buoyancy and then build your own sea-worthy creation. Teams will work together in this interactive program to build aluminum foil boats and see which boat can hold the most pennies.

The Brecksville Branch is conveniently located across the street from the Brecksville Community Center and the Kids Quarters playground area. In 2006, the branch suffered extensive flood damage that required the building to be closed for nearly six months while repairs were made. The newly remodeled building reopened on January 14, 2007.
